首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

适用于.net核心的Windows工作流基础

Windows工作流基础(Windows Workflow Foundation,简称WF)是微软推出的一种面向.net平台的工作流引擎,用于开发和执行具有业务流程特征的应用程序。它提供了一个规范化的工作流程执行框架,使开发人员能够轻松地创建和管理复杂的工作流应用。

Windows工作流基础主要有以下特点和优势:

  1. 可视化设计:Windows工作流基础提供了一个可视化的设计器,开发人员可以通过拖拽和连接活动来定义工作流程,简化了工作流的设计和调试过程。
  2. 可扩展性:Windows工作流基础支持自定义活动和活动库的开发,可以根据业务需求扩展和定制工作流的功能,提高了工作流的灵活性和适用性。
  3. 分布式执行:Windows工作流基础支持工作流的分布式执行,可以将工作流程在多个服务器上执行,实现负载均衡和高可用性。
  4. 高度可靠性:Windows工作流基础具备事务性的特点,可以确保工作流的执行过程具备原子性和一致性。
  5. 与.NET生态系统的紧密集成:Windows工作流基础与.NET平台紧密集成,可以与其他.NET技术(如ASP.NET、WCF等)无缝协作,为开发人员提供了更多的灵活性和选择性。

Windows工作流基础适用于以下场景:

  1. 业务流程自动化:Windows工作流基础可以用于实现企业中的各类业务流程自动化,例如请假审批、订单处理、工作流程管理等。
  2. 任务调度和流程编排:Windows工作流基础可以用于实现任务的调度和流程的编排,可以根据业务需求灵活调整工作流程的执行顺序和条件。
  3. 异步处理:Windows工作流基础可以用于处理异步的业务流程,例如后台任务的处理、消息队列的消费等。
  4. 工作流管理系统:Windows工作流基础可以用于实现工作流管理系统,提供工作流程的版本控制、权限管理、日志跟踪等功能。

腾讯云相关产品和产品介绍链接地址: 腾讯云并没有专门针对Windows工作流基础的产品,但可以通过使用腾讯云的云服务器(CVM)和容器服务(TKE)等基础设施产品来支持运行和部署Windows工作流基础应用。具体的产品信息和介绍可以参考腾讯云的官方文档和网站。

请注意:以上回答仅代表我的个人观点,不针对特定品牌商。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共50个视频
动力节点-Javaweb项目入门到精通【eclipse】-4
动力节点Java培训
本套课程是JavaScript的进阶课程,适用于已经学习了JavaScript基础知识的同学,如果你想继续对JavaScript的面向对象以及高级应用进行深入地学习,那么本套课程就是为你量身定做的,课程将会围绕对象,构造函数以及高级应用三个部分来展开,你将收获到对象的创建、属性的特征、操作原型对象、原型链继承、闭包、深浅拷贝等方面的知识,提高对JavaScript的认知深度。
共11个视频
动力节点-Javaweb项目入门到精通【eclipse】-5
动力节点Java培训
本套课程是JavaScript的进阶课程,适用于已经学习了JavaScript基础知识的同学,如果你想继续对JavaScript的面向对象以及高级应用进行深入地学习,那么本套课程就是为你量身定做的,课程将会围绕对象,构造函数以及高级应用三个部分来展开,你将收获到对象的创建、属性的特征、操作原型对象、原型链继承、闭包、深浅拷贝等方面的知识,提高对JavaScript的认知深度。
共2个视频
敲敲云零代码平台-入门视频教程
JEECG
敲敲云是一个APaaS平台,帮助企业快速搭建个性化业务应用。用户不需要代码开发就能够搭建出用户体验上佳的销售、运营、人事、采购等核心业务应用,打通企业内部数据。平台内的自动化工作流还可以实现审批、填写等控制流程和业务自动化,如果用户企业使用钉钉或企业微信,也可以将平台内搭建的应用直接对接到工作台上。
共17个视频
Oracle数据库实战精讲教程-数据库零基础教程【动力节点】
动力节点Java培训
视频中讲解了Oracle数据库基础、搭建Oracle数据库环境、SQL*Plus命令行工具的使用、标准SQL、Oracle数据核心-表空间、Oracle数据库常用对象,数据库性能优化,数据的导出与导入,索引,视图,连接查询,子查询,Sequence,数据库设计三范式等。
领券